Perinatal outcomes after maternal 2009/H1N1 infection: national cohort study
Matthias Pierce1, Jennifer J Kurinczuk, Patsy Spark
1National Perinatal Epidemiology Unit, University of Oxford, Oxford OX3 7LF, UK.
Objectives:
To follow up a UK national cohort of women admitted to hospital with confirmed 2009/H1N1 influenza in pregnancy in order to obtain a complete picture of pregnancy outcomes and estimate the risks of adverse fetal and infant outcomes.
Design:
National cohort study.
Setting:
221 hospitals with obstetrician led maternity units in the UK.
Participants:
256 women admitted to hospital with confirmed 2009/H1N1 in pregnancy during the second wave of pandemic infection between September 2009 and January 2010; 1220 pregnant women for comparison.
Main Outcome Measures:
Rates of stillbirth, perinatal mortality, and neonatal mortality; odds ratios for infected versus comparison women.
Results:
Perinatal mortality was higher in infants born to infected women (10 deaths among 256 infants; rate 39 (95% confidence interval 19 to 71) per 1000 total births) than in infants of uninfected women (9 deaths among 1233 infants; rate 7 (3 to 13) per 1000 total births) (P < 0.001). This was principally explained by an increase in the rate of stillbirth (27 per 1000 total births v 6 per 1000 total births; P = 0.001). Infants of infected women were also more likely to be born prematurely than were infants of comparison women (adjusted odds ratio 4.0, 95% confidence interval 2.7 to 5.9). Infected women who delivered preterm were more likely to be infected in their third trimester (P = 0.046), to have been admitted to an intensive care unit (P < 0.001), and to have a secondary pneumonia (P = 0.001) than were those who delivered at term.
Conclusions:
This study suggests an increase in the risk of poor outcomes of pregnancy in women infected with 2009/H1N1, which reinforces the message from studies of maternal risk alone. The health of pregnant women is an important public health priority in future waves of this and other influenza pandemics.
